March 7, 201311 yr Author Are the 2013 Yamaha V forged as forgiving as the 2011 Onoff forged?? Mmmm I dunno! The Onoff's were longer, at least a club, iron per iron BUT these new Yamahas play about 3/8" shorter! The Onoff's have the edge on feel but be the smallest of margins( not had a lot of game time with the Yamahas due to poor weather and me been busy busy) That all said there's just something about the Yamaha Heads that make you wanna smile, hit them and play good Golf! I can hit more types of shots with the Yams... With the Onoff's I felt that you could just Hit the ball , almost felt I couldn't miss( I did many times) As for your question, strangely YES these seem to give you more than enough forgiveness ... I can't help but think I should have taken the plunge and got the Tour models!! That said these are lovely... Just as the pitch says, blade looks Cavity forgiveness!!, which I didn't believe until I hit mine! In the light of recent events , just maybe Yamaha will be my new Epon??
